The Radisson Hotel chain is the latest American retail company to announce
it has suffered a significant breach of its computer systems resulting in
the compromise of credit and debit card data.
In an open letter to guests on the hotel's Web site
(http://www.radisson.com/openletter/openletter.html) Radisson said that
the breach had occurred for a number of months, from November 2008 until
May 2009, but said the investigation had not revealed how many card
numbers might have been compromised. It also revealed that the data
accessed may have included the name printed on a guest's credit card or
debit card, a credit or debit card number, and/or a card expiration date.
